The TRANSPOSE function in Excel is a powerful tool that allows users to switch the orientation of a range of cells. This function can convert rows to columns and columns to rows, which is particularly useful for organizing data and enhancing readability. By using the TRANSPOSE function, users can manipulate datasets effortlessly to suit their analytical needs.
The VSTACK function in Excel is a powerful tool that allows users to vertically stack multiple arrays or ranges of data into a single unified array. This function simplifies data organization and enhances data management by allowing seamless integration of data from various sources. Ideal for users who work with large datasets, VSTACK provides a straightforward syntax and is compatible with both existing and dynamic arrays.
The WRAPCOLS function in Excel is a powerful tool that allows users to transform a single column of data into multiple columns, wrapping the data as needed based on a specified number of rows. This function is particularly useful for organizing and presenting data neatly in a columnar format. With its straightforward implementation, users can easily control the layout of their data for better clarity and analysis.
